The narrative of the new film unfolds twenty years after the events of the original movie. Miranda Priestly, the chief editor of the fashion magazine 'Runway,' faces new challenges stemming from the decline of print media and the transition to the digital world. To navigate these changes, Miranda decides to invite her former assistant, Andy, who, unlike her previous career in the fashion industry, has chosen to pursue journalism.
The first film, 'The Devil Wears Prada,' was adapted from the novel of the same name by Lauren Weisberger, published in 2003. The screenplay for the sequel has been penned by Aline Brosh McKenna, who also worked on the script for the first installment. David Frankel returns as the director for both films, ensuring that the style and atmosphere of the original movie are preserved.
Once again, the film features the stars from the first installment: Meryl Streep as Miranda Priestly, Anne Hathaway as Andy, Emily Blunt as Emily, and Stanley Tucci as Nigel. Additionally, viewers will be treated to performances by actors such as Kenneth Branagh, Simone Ashley, Justin Theroux, Lucy Liu, Patrick Bremmoll, and others.
